Maharashtra assembly breach of privilege case: SC grants protection from arrest to Arnab Goswami

NEW DELHI: The Supreme Court on Friday granted protection to Republic TV editor-in-chief from arrest in the Maharashtra assembly proceedings initiated against him for using foul language against state chief minister Uddhav Thackeray.
The top court slammed the secretary of the assembly for threatening Goswami and said every citizen has the right under Article 32 of the Constitution to approach the apex court directly and said that because Goswami came to the Supreme Court, he cannot be threatened in this manner.
The court asked the Maharashtra assembly secretary to show cause in two weeks why a contempt proceeding should not be initiated against him for threatening Goswami for showing assembly notice issued to him to the apex Court.
